Output 2fd35cae56eced868ba24a33ef9fb31ce14049767908759eca2d14a5bedb6ee9:1

value
27659554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f96b76b4757d3ce4ad660fe879cdff0539ba895b OP_EQUAL
address
3QRpv1ykE5nPAnqoSoNJbD2WFaqWp7YTvB
transaction
2fd35cae56eced868ba24a33ef9fb31ce14049767908759eca2d14a5bedb6ee9
spent
true